Dominance MMA leader, Ali Abdelaziz, who also manages UFC welterweight champion Kamaru Usman, revealed that former undisputed title contender Nick Diaz can become the number 1 contender for Usman’s title if he beats Robbie Lawler at UFC 266.
Diaz, who last fought in 2015, will make his long-awaited return against the man who he has already beaten once at UFC 47 almost 17 years ago.

Meanwhile, Usman is gearing up for a clash against Colby Covington at UFC 268. The Nigerian will look to defend his title successfully in a rematch from UFC 245. Even if he successfully defeats ‘Chaos’, Usman is not short of challenges.

His next potential opponents could be Leon Edwards or Gilbert Burns. Both these fighters have already lost to the champ but have made the progression to stake a claim towards the gold. There is also a strong case of Vicente Luque challenging for the gold, as he has also been impressive in his last few fights.

Keeping aside all these fighters, Abdelaziz has thrown Diaz’s name out of nowhere. In a retweet, the veteran manager replied to MMA Junkie’s John Morgan and wrote, “If nick Diaz beat Robbie Lawler he become the number one contender automatically. Hey bring too much to the table.”

In an additional tweet from John Morgan, the reporter mentioned Abdelaziz is content with Nick facing Usman if he wins and others can wait. Abdelaziz said, “Then everyone else can keep waiting.”
How did Nick Diaz fare in his last few matches?
Nick (26-9), the elder brother of Nate Diaz, will make an appearance inside the octagon after 6 long years. The Stockton native last featured in a match against former UFC middleweight champion, Anderson Silva. The fight ended in a loss for Nick as Silva picked up a unanimous decision.

However, the bout was overturned later as a No Contest after both fighters were charged with using unwanted substances. Thus, both were fined and subsequently banned after that. Prior to this, he fought Georges St-Pierre for the welterweight gold at UFC 158. He lost that bout via unanimous decision.
